Comprehensive Guide to Post-Op Form

What is the Post-Operative Follow-Up Form?

The post-operative follow-up form is a crucial document in medical practices, used to accurately document surgical outcomes and any complications that may arise. This form serves as a key resource for healthcare providers to monitor a patient's recovery journey, ensuring that they can deliver comprehensive post-operative care. Additionally, it plays a significant role for patients, helping them understand their surgical experience and recovery process.
By systematically recording essential information, the post-operative follow-up form enhances communication between healthcare providers and patients. It ultimately contributes to better health outcomes and a higher standard of care.

Key Features of the Post-Operative Follow-Up Form

The post-op form includes several key sections designed to capture essential patient information effectively. These sections typically encompass patient demographics, details of the surgical procedure, and a thorough assessment of outcomes to ensure all relevant data is gathered.
  • Patient Information: Name, ID, Age, Sex
  • Surgery Details: Date of Surgery, MD's Description of Operation
  • Outcomes Tracking: Results of surgery and any complications
  • Assessment of Complications: Anesthetic complications and surgical technical issues
